STATE, IN INTEREST OF A.C.


115 N.J. Super. 77 (1971)

278 A.2d 225

STATE IN THE INTEREST OF A.C. STATE OF NEW JERSEY, COMPLAINANT-RESPONDENT, v. A.C., JUVENILE-APPELLANT.

Superior Court of New Jersey, Appellate Division.

Decided June 3, 1971.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Mr. William S. Gurkin, assigned attorney, argued the cause for appellant.

Mr. Elson P. Kendall, Assistant Prosecutor, argued the cause for respondent (Mr. Karl Asch, Union County Prosecutor, attorney; Mr. Arthur J. Timins, Assistant Prosecutor, on the brief).

Before Judges LEWIS, MATTHEWS and MINTZ.


The opinion of the court was delivered by LEWIS, P.J.A.D.

A.C., a juvenile, appeals from an adjudication of delinquency in the Union County Juvenile and Domestic Relations Court, whereby he was committed to the "New Jersey Reformatory for Males"; the sentence was suspended and the youth was placed on probation.
